Mental Causation : : Investigating the Mind’s Powers in a Natural World / / Jens Harbecke.
This work is a systematic investigation of a range of solutions offered today for the philosophical problem of mental causation. The premises constituting the problem are analyzed before a survey is developed of the most popular theories on mental causation. It is demonstrated in detail why most of...
